A bathroom renovation in Bangor is not only about new tiles and tapware. The condition of the subfloor, wall framing, plumbing locations, ventilation and waterproofing all affect the final result. In older bathrooms, we often need to consider water damage, poor falls to waste, dated pipework or layouts that waste space. These details should be checked before committing to a design.

Many home renovations in Bangor focus on improving the connection between kitchen, dining and living areas. Older homes may have smaller separate rooms, limited natural light or storage that no longer suits the way the household works. Removing or altering walls can be effective, but it needs proper assessment because some walls may be load-bearing or may contain services.

When a Bangor home no longer has enough space, an extension may be more practical than moving. Depending on the site and existing structure, this could mean adding a rear living area, extending the ground floor, creating another bedroom, building over part of the home or improving outdoor entertaining areas. The right option depends on the block, access, roof structure and planning pathway.
We work through ground floor extensions, upper floor extensions and decks and pergolas with a focus on buildability. For sloping or tighter sites, the design may need extra consideration around excavation, drainage, scaffolding, material handling and neighbour access. These practical details can have a real impact on cost and timing.

3. Construction, Fit-Off and Handover
Construction usually moves through preparation, demolition, framing or structural work, services, lining, waterproofing, tiling, cabinetry, fit-off and final checks. The sequence changes depending on whether we are completing kitchen renovation work, wet areas, structural alterations or an extension.

What Affects Renovation Costs in Bangor?
Renovation costs vary because every existing home is different. A straightforward bathroom refresh is very different from a bathroom that needs new plumbing, floor repairs, drainage changes and full waterproofing. A kitchen renovation may be simple if the layout stays the same, but costs can change when walls are removed, services move or custom joinery is required. For home extensions in Bangor, the main cost drivers often include project size, structural steel, excavation, roof integration, access, scaffolding, engineering, approvals, materials and the condition of the existing home. Sloping blocks, tight side access or complex staging can also affect labour time. We do not provide fixed prices without seeing the property because a realistic quote needs to reflect the actual scope.
